The article presents an analysis of the current state of soybean production in the Russian Federation. It is shown that the production of this valuable high-protein oilseed crop over the previous years has made a huge breakthrough in conquering the market and increasing its share in the country’s total agricultural production. In Russia, in 2023, a record was set for the gross soybean production in history, with a total grain of 6.8 million tons. At the same time, the production leader also changed: from the traditional Far East, where soybeans have been cultivated for more than 100 years, to the Central Federal District, which has achieved the largest gross soybean yields in the country – about 3.0 million tons. Production growth is realized not only through extensive development paths, but also through increasing crop productivity. In 2023, the average yield in the country was 1.92 t/ha, which is also a historical maximum. It should be noted that in increasing productivity, the direction has been taken, according to the Food Security Doctrine, to increase to 75% the share of seeds of domestic varieties in the total volume by 2030, and for this there are all the necessary resources.
